Web9 sep. 2024 · The Select by Color tool is designed to select areas of an image based on color similarity. You can access the Select by Color Tool in different ways: Choose Tools Selection Tools By Color Select from the image menu bar. in the ToolBox, by selecting the tool icon, by using the keyboard shortcut Shift +O. For removing background, we have to make a selection around our main object, and for making a selection, we have a number of tools and ways in GIMP. shovelmouth boy ice ageWeb17 feb. 2024 · The fastest way to deselect (remove selection) in GIMP is to use the keyboard shortcut Ctrl (Command if you use Mac) + Shift + A, which runs the Select None command. The Shift key is often added to shortcuts to reverse their effect.
